Abstract

Development of novel textile preforming concepts driven by multi-objective optimisation techniques will be reported here. One of the main goals here is to completely relax the manufacturing constraints imposed by conventional textile machinery. Several examples towards this goal are presented in this paper. Robotic/mechatronic concepts have been employed in creating optimised fibre architectures.
